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Birr Advance Factory.

74.

asked the Minister for Industry and Commerce if he is aware that the IDA have almost completed the building of an advance factory at Birr, County Offaly; and if any further developments have taken place in regard to the siting of an industry there which is urgently needed in the area.

I am aware that the construction of the advance factory in Birr is due for completion in March next.

The IDA have been making particular efforts to attract industry to Birr, including a project for the advance factory, but I understand that so far no definite commitment has been received.

Could the Minister give me any information in regard to the number of industrialists or potential industrialists the IDA have brought to visit this advance factory site in Birr?

I have not got the figure. I know that in view of the situation in Birr it is looked on as a place for which particular effort is being made by the IDA. We recognise that there is a difficulty there. I might inform the Deputy and also the public that the IDA have also purchased a further 15 acre site in Birr for industrial development. This is evidence of our awareness and our concern, but we have not got a firm project at this time.

The news that an extra 15 acre site has been purchased will be welcome. Is the Minister aware, and are the IDA fully aware, that there is a large number of skilled people in the town and that over many years this town has suffered serious loss of employment due to a number of factories closing? Will he continue to make the special effort which he appears to be making?

We are indeed so aware. The advance factory is 24,000 square feet which is a little bigger than many of the advance factories. Fifteen acres is a very substantial lump of land for industrial development. Both of these are evidence of our awareness and our concern.
